What to do?? Hang tight. There's no way you put on 4 lbs of FAT from 1 slice of pizza and a beer. If it's TOM that's putting on the WATER weight, once it's gone, the weight will be gone too. I know it's hard, but be patient. Know that you've done everything right, take confidence in it. The scale is measuring what we weigh. And what we weigh WILL change from day to day based on TOM, the foods we've eaten (their content) and other factors. Don't let it get to you. Stick with the program. This too shall pass.
